TRO opens sewing training centre at Thampalakamam
[TamilNet, Friday, 08 August 2003, 22:29 GMT]
The Tamils Rehabilitation Organization Friday afternoon opened a training centre to teach sewing to unemployed girls in Thampalakamam, a traditional Tamil village 24 km off Trincomalee town. At the start, about twenty women have been enrolled to obtain training in the centre, said the Trincomalee Dstrict Director of the TRO, Mr.K.Mathavarajah, speaking at the opening event held at the TRO office in
Thampalakamam.
At the commencement, Mr.Mathavarajah lit the traditional oil lamp. Thereafter the LTTE’s Tampalakamam political head, Mr.S.Thirumalai, declared open the training centre by cutting the ribbon. The LTTE’s Trincomalee district political head, Mr.S.Thilak, later handed over the
scissor and cloth to the teacher in charge of the sewing training centre to
commence work. The TRO’s Tampalakamam head, Mr.S.Nallasviam, presided over a meeting that
followed the opening of the centre. ”Several non-governmental organizations are implementing development projects in the Trincomalee district according to their needs. The TRO has selected projects to cater to the needs of the society. Hence the TRO now has opened a sewing training centre in Thampalakamam village to enable unemployed girls to train themselves in a vocation that could provide income for their livelihood,” said Mr.Mathavarajah.
